Neurosurgery

Mount Sinai is a recognized leader in neurosurgery, offering advanced treatments for brain tumors, spinal disorders, stroke, brain aneurysms, epilepsy and other neurological disorders. Our neurosurgeons are pioneering new techniques in skull-base surgery and minimally invasive surgery to greatly reduce recovery times and to optimize the health of our patients. Our scientists conduct cutting-edge research to find novel therapies to improve clinical outcomes for patients with brain and spinal tumors.
